title = "Low-jitter transmission code for 4-PAM signaling in serial links",
abstract = "In this paper, we propose a new low-jitter transmission code for 4-PAM signaling in serial links. It is {"}8B/10B like code{"} which preserves all good properties of the 8B/10B code, such as DC balanced of the serial data and guaranteed enough transitions in the symbol stream for clock recovery. Further, it is effective to reduce the jitter of timing recovery and consumes half the bandwidth to transmit in 4-PAM. The design results using TSMC 0.25μm process shows that it can reduce the jitter of the transition time by ± 25%. The operation speed of the 8B/10B like encoder / decoder is 500 MHz with 16-bit inputs (8 Gbps) and 476 MHz with 16-bit outputs (7.6 Gbps).",
